  • Posting messages:
    This list serves an international audience.
    As a courtesy to our international community please specify
    all measurements in standard international format:

    • Give temperatures in degrees Celsius (with Fahrenheit as well if desired)
      and plant sizes, distances, etc., in metric units (with imperial units as well if desired).
    • There are two conversion tables on the Web Site and in the 'Footer' of the message to assist anyone needing to convert measurements for posts.
    • Use scientific names for conifers, rather than local vernacular names which can be confusing or misleading.
    • In order to get a correct answer, it is recommended members use a Signature:
      Your full name, country (and state or region in large countries with diverse climates), USDA hardiness zone (or other climate zone) including temperature in Celsius (and optionally also in Fahrenheit), type of soil, and any other physical or environmental influences that might be pertinent to growing.
    • Post in English language, or botanical Latin with an English summary.
